Play.com launches E3 zone

Games and entertainment retailer Play.com has introduced a dedicated E3 section to its website where consumers can buy newly announced games.

The Play.com E3 area is being promoted from the retailer’s homepage and offers up to 20 per cent off the latest games.

Titles currently include Gears of War 3, Deus Ex: Human Revolution, Fable III and Call of Duty: Black Ops – all of which will make an appearance at E3. The page is broken down into sections, featuring highlights on the PS3, Xbox 360, PC, Wii and DS.

E3 2010 officially kicks off tomorrow and will run until Thursday 17th June. It’s E3 press day today and Microsoft is scheduled to announce its conference shortly.
